Congress-DMK talks continue on seat sharing in Tamil Nadu Assembly elections

The talks between DMK and Congress on seat sharing issue in the Tamil Nadu Assemby elections are continuing. DMK Ministers M.K. Alagiri and Dayanidhi Maran met Congress President Sonia Gandhi late last night to iron out the difference of opinion between the two parties on the issue.Earlier, DMK put on hold the resignation of its six ministers from the UPA Government. Deputy Chief Minister of Tamli Nadu M K Stalin told reporters in Chennai that Senior Congress leader Pranab Mukherjee telephoned DMK chief M Karunanidhi twice and urged him not to pull out his Ministers from the cabinet during the Budget Session and sought a day's time to resolve problems. Mr. Stalin hoped that a decision on the issue of seat sharing will be reached soon.
